Understanding Behavior: Common Psychological Patterns
People typically exhibit common psychological patterns that might offer a glimpse into their actions . Recognizing these general frameworks – such as cognitive dissonance – assists us to better interpret why others respond the way they do. For instance , the inclination to look for information that supports existing beliefs – known as confirmation bias – impacts decision-making and might lead to flawed judgments. Understanding such psychological concepts improves interpersonal relationships and encourages more empathetic communication.
